Britney Spears Deletes Instagram Amid Kevin Federline Memoir Controversy

Reetam Bodhak by Reetam Bodhak
November 4, 2025
in Entertainment, Music
0
Britney Spears

Britney Spears has deactivated her Instagram account following weeks of concerning posts and escalating tensions with ex-husband Kevin Federline. The pop icon’s social media departure on November 2 comes amid backlash over Federline’s memoir You Thought You Knew, which contains allegations about Spears’ mental health and parenting—claims she’s vehemently denied.

Britney Spears Timeline of Recent Events

DateEvent
October 7Britney posts video showing bruises and bandages
October 19Emotional post about 2018 rehab experience
October 21Kevin Federline’s memoir released
Late OctoberMultiple defensive posts on X (Twitter)
November 2Instagram account deactivated

The sequence suggests mounting pressure from the memoir controversy influenced Spears’ decision to step away from the platform.

The Concerning October Posts

Fans raised alarms when Spears posted a dancing video on October 7 displaying visible bruises on her arms and bandages on her wrists. The Toxic singer quickly addressed the injuries, explaining she fell down stairs at a friend’s house.

“My boys had to leave and go back to Maui. This is the way I express myself and pray through art,” Spears wrote in the caption. “I’m not here for concern or pity, I just want to be a good woman and be better.”

According to People Magazine, the post sparked immediate concern among her fanbase, who noted the emotional weight behind her explanation and her reference to sons Sean Preston and Jayden James returning to their father.

The Rehab Revelation Post

On October 19, Spears shared a deeply personal post about her four-month rehab stint in 2018 during her 13-year conservatorship. Using metaphorical language comparing herself to Maleficent, she discussed feeling her “wings were taken away.”

“For a person like me who understands the sacredness is god speed… it did more than hurt my body,” Spears wrote. “Trust me there’s ALOT I didn’t share in my book and still things at this very moment I’ve kept hidden because its incredibly painful and sad.”

The post referenced her 2023 memoir The Woman In Me while revealing she withheld significant details about her conservatorship experience. She claimed the rehab period caused “brain damage” and left her unable to dance or move for five months.

The Federline Memoir Feud

Kevin Federline’s memoir You Thought You Knew, released October 21, contains multiple allegations about Spears’ mental health, their relationship dynamics, and her behavior around their children. The book’s timing—just two years after Spears’ conservatorship ended—has drawn criticism from fans who view it as exploitative.

Spears responded to the allegations through multiple posts on X (formerly Twitter), defending her parenting and mental health while criticizing Federline’s decision to publish intimate details about their relationship.

Why the Instagram Deletion Matters

Social media has been Spears’ primary communication channel since gaining freedom from her conservatorship in 2021. Her Instagram featured regular dancing videos, personal reflections, and direct responses to media narratives—making it her most authentic public voice.

The deletion represents a significant withdrawal from public engagement, potentially indicating she’s seeking space from scrutiny during a difficult period. Unlike temporary breaks, full account deactivation suggests a more definitive decision to disconnect.

The Conservatorship Shadow

Spears’ recent posts heavily reference her conservatorship experience, which lasted from 2008 to 2021. During those 13 years, her father Jamie Spears controlled her personal, financial, and professional decisions—a situation that sparked the #FreeBritney movement.

The conservatorship ended following court testimony where Spears detailed alleged abuse, forced medication, and inability to make basic life decisions. Her memoir The Woman In Me later revealed additional disturbing details about that period.

According to Rolling Stone’s conservatorship coverage, the experience left lasting psychological impacts that Spears continues processing publicly.

Fan Reactions and Support

The #FreeBritney movement, which helped end her conservatorship, has rallied around Spears again. Fans express concern over her wellbeing while criticizing Federline’s memoir timing as deliberately harmful during her healing process.

Many supporters argue that Spears deserves privacy and peace after years of public exploitation, viewing the Instagram deletion as a healthy boundary rather than a crisis.

What Comes Next

Spears’ team has not issued official statements about the Instagram deletion or her current wellbeing. Her X account remains active, though she hasn’t posted since late October.

The situation highlights ongoing challenges public figures face balancing transparency with self-preservation, especially after trauma. Spears’ decision to step back may ultimately prove the healthiest choice during this turbulent period.
